🥂 Episode 10: Pinot Gris / Pinot Grigio
Today, we’re uncorking a glass of Pinot Gris—aka Pinot Grigio—and exploring the many faces of this globe-trotting grape. From zippy, sun-soaked sips in Italy to rich, textured pours from Alsace and beyond, this episode dives into what makes this white wine grape such a delicious chameleon in the world of vino.
Here’s what you’ll learn in today’s episode:
- Why Pinot Gris and Pinot Grigio are the same grape—but taste totally different depending on where they’re grown
- How this grape mutated from Pinot Noir and wears its pinkish-gray skins with pride
- The surprising styles this grape takes on—from crisp and citrusy to rich and honeyed
- What foods to pair with the different expressions of Pinot Gris and Pinot Grigio
- How skin contact can turn this “white” wine a rosy copper color, known as “Ramato” in Italy
